How much do all cleaning j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for all cleaning in the United States is $14.81,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.50 and $16.35 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are 'All Cleaning' jobs?

'All Cleaning' jobs refer to a broad range of positions involved in cleaning and maintaining various types of spaces, such as homes, offices, commercial buildings, and public areas. These jobs can include tasks like sweeping, mopping, dusting, sanitizing surfaces, emptying trash, and sometimes specialized cleaning such as carpet or window cleaning. Employees in these roles may work individually or as part of a team and are responsible for ensuring that environments are safe, hygienic, and presentable. The job requirements can vary depending on the setting and the employer, but attention to detail and reliability are important qualities for these positions.

What are some common challenges cleaning professionals face in maintaining high standards across multiple client sites?

Cleaning professionals often manage several client sites with varying expectations and requirements. Common challenges include adapting to different types of surfaces and materials, managing time efficiently to meet tight schedules, and ensuring consistent quality despite high workloads. Additionally, cleaners must stay updated on best practices and safe handling of chemicals, while also communicating effectively with site managers and team members to address any issues promptly. Overcoming these challenges often involves continuous training, attention to detail, and strong organizational skills.
